dc.descriptionEl orden Hymenoptera que comprende las avispas, abejas, abejorros, hormigas e insectos vespiformes, es el segundo grupo de hexápodos más diversos a nivel mundial, esto permite que los encontremos en la mayoría de los ecosistemas generando interacciones que son fundamentales dentro de los mismos, de estas interacciones se generan los servicios ecosistémicos como la polinización, bioturbación de suelo, descomposición y control biológico. En la presente investigación se determina la diversidad de himenópteros asociados a Ubaque – Cundinamarca; se determinaron cuatro coberturas vegetales denominadas como: Maizal, Pastizal, Policultivo y Remanente de Bosque, todas ellas presentes en la vereda Santa Ana; se realizaron un total de 48 muestreos para todas las coberturas, con un total de 120 horas de trabajo activo. Se implementaron los números de Hill para determinar la diversidad alfa y para el análisis de la diversidad beta, se utilizó el índice de Bray Curtis, se obtuvieron un total de 3503 individuos, donde el policultivo es el más abundante y el pastizal el que menos ejemplares registra; Los Braconidae e Ichneumonidae son las familias más abundantes, mientras que Scoliidae y Siricidae las familias con solo un individuo colectado.
dc.description.abstractThe order Hymenoptera that includes wasps, bees, bumblebees, ants and vespiform insects, is the second most diverse group of hexapods worldwide, this allows us to find them in most ecosystems generating interactions that are fundamental within them, from these interactions are generated ecosystem services such as pollination, soil bioturbation, decomposition and biological control. In the present research, the diversity of hymenoptera associated with Ubaque - Cundinamarca is determined; four plant coverages were identified as: Maizal, Pastizal, Policultivo and Remanente de Bosque, all of which are found in Santa Ana; a total of 48 samples were taken for all coverage, with a total of 120 hours of active work. Hill numbers were used to determine alpha diversity and for analysis of beta diversity, the Bray Curtis index was used, a total of 3503 individuals were obtained, where the polyculture is the most abundant and the grassland has the fewest specimens; The Braconidae and Ichneumonidae are the most abundant families, while Scoliidae and Siricidae are the families with only one individual collected.
